About the Opportunity  

The Director of IT and Security serves as a strategic leader in the organization’s technology landscape, responsible for overseeing all aspects of IT strategy, security, and operational management. This role requires a strong focus on aligning technology initiatives with business objectives while ensuring the highest standards of data integrity and security. The ideal candidate will foster innovation within the IT team, manage budgets effectively, and implement best practices for technology governance, security, and compliance.

Key Responsibilities 

Vision and Strategy

  • Develop and implement a forward-looking IT and security strategy that aligns with SweetRush’s goals and enhances overall organizational impact.
  • Collaborate with executive leadership to assess and respond to current and future technology needs and opportunities.
  • Establish key performance indicators (KPIs) and service level agreements to track IT performance and service delivery.

Team Leadership

  • Lead, mentor, and inspire the IT and security team, promoting a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ement.
  • Conduct regular performance assessments and provide professional development opportunities for team members.

Project Management

  • Oversee the planning, execution, and delivery of IT projects,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and completion within established timeframes and budgets.
  • Utilize structured approaches to support the planning and execution of IT initiatives, ensuring process efficiency and effectiveness.

Security Governance

  • Ensure the security, integrity, and availability of data and IT systems by implementing robust security measures, including access controls, monitoring, and incident response protocols.
  • Create and customize homegrown tools for security validation and access control, ensuring they are effectively integrated into existing security frameworks.
  • Develop and maintain disaster recovery and business continuity plans to mitigate the impact of potential IT disruptions and enhance organizational resilience.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and industry standards regarding data privacy and information security.
  • Ensure annual SOC2 recertification, including engaging and managing the third-party vendor, along with managing the internal process.

Technology Infrastructure and Operations

  • Lead the design and implementation of a scalable and secure technology infrastructure that supports operational needs, including cloud and on-premises solutions.
  • Manage the IT budget, ensuring cost-effective resources while optimizing technology investments and contract negotiations.

Innovation and Emerging Technologies

  • Stay informed about emerging technologies and industry trends, proactively identifying opportunities for adoption to enhance operational effectiveness and drive innovation.
  • Collaborate with other departments to integrate new technologies effectively and leverage data analytics and artificial intelligence to support strategic decision-making.

Stakeholder Engagement

  • Build strong relationships with internal stakeholders and external partners, ensuring alignment on technology initiatives and fostering a collaborative approach to problem-solving.
  • Provide timely support to other departments, especially sales and legal, for client-facing opportunities and documents
  • Advocate for technology initiatives that enhance organizational capacity and deliver measurable impact.

Qualifications  

  • A minimum of 10 years of progressive experience in IT management, with strong expertise in technology operations and security oversight.
  • Equivalent technical experience and accomplishments will be considered in lieu of formal educational qualifications.
  • Proven experience leading IT teams and managing cross-functional projects, with a track record of successful technology strategy implementation.
  • Deep hands-on experience in Linux environments, as well as a strong foundation in security best practices and compliance standards.

 Skills & Competencies

  • Strong le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ills with a proven ability to build trusting relationships and influence stakeholders.
  • Exceptional problem-solving and analytical skills, with the ability to think strategically and execute tactically.
  • High level of emotional intelligence, with a commitment to fostering an inclusive and collaborative work environment.
  • Passion for technology and innovation, with a proactive approach to staying ahead of trends and challenges in the IT landscape.
